Ambiguous Stimulus
A type of stimulus that can be interpreted in more than one way, often used in psychological tests to study perception and personality.
Type of Test
Refers to the classification of tests based on their purpose, structure, or content, such as personality tests, intelligence tests, or achievement tests.
Projective Test
A type of psychological assessment that uses ambiguous stimuli to elicit responses that reflect aspects of an individual's personality.
Drawings of People
A projective psychological test or method where individuals express their emotions, desires, and internal conflicts through doodles or structured images of humans.
